Is Kinder Joy banned in America?

Why are Kinder Eggs banned in the US? The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etics Act prohibits Kinder Eggs, as they don’t allow confectionary products to contain a “non-nutritive object”. … Kinder Surprise eggs are legal in Canada and Mexico, but are illegal to import into the US.

What do you get in Kinder Joy?

KINDER JOY® is a delicious treat made of two soft cream layers – one sweet milk-cream flavored and one cocoa flavored. Nestled into the creamy layers are two round, chocolate-covered wafer bites that are filled with sweet cocoa cream, to be eaten with the included spoon.

How do you eat a Kinder Joy?

The U.S.-friendly Kinder Joy Eggs do not come ensconced in chocolate. Instead, shoppers will get two plastic halves of an egg. Inside one half, you will find the toy. Inside the other half, you will find “milk-crème and cocoa flavoring with wafer bites” and a spoon to eat it with, according to Fortune.

What does Kinder Joy taste like?

It’s a mix of milky and cocoa cream, it’s quite thick and there’s a fair amount of it. The combination of flavours does give it a taste similar to that of the hazelnut cream you’d find in a Kinder Bueno, but there is in fact no hazelnut in here.

What are the ingredients in Kinder Joy?

Ferrero Kinder Joy Sugar, Vegetable Oils (Palm, Peanut and Sunflower), Skim Milk Powder, Wheat Flour, Cocoa, Wheat Germ, Wheat Starch, Cocoa Mass, Malt Extract, Soy Lecithin as Emulsifier, Whey Proteins, Cocoa Butter, Artificial Flavors, Ammonium Bicarbonate and Sodium Bicarbonate as Leavening Agents, Salt.

When did Kinder Joy come to India?

After a brief market test in south India, it launched its products at the national level in May 2010. The firm makes Kinder Joy and Tic Tac at its Baramati factory.

What is inside a Kinder egg?

For starters, the egg is made of plastic, not chocolate. It also has a different name: Kinder Joy. When cracked open, the Joy splits into two separately sealed halves, one containing the toy, the other holding a swirl of edible cream, two chocolate wafer balls and a small plastic spoon.

Where is kinder joy banned?

No, unlike its sister product — Kinder Surprise — Kinder Joy is not banned in the United States. The candy was made available in stores in 2017. The product was made specifically to meet the Food and Drug Administration’s (FDA) rule of not encasing non-edible items in an edible casing.
